Generative Cell
In the development of pollen grains, the cell that divides to form the sperm cells necessary forplant fertilization.
Sepals
The part of a flower that typically acts as a protective covering for the flower in bud form and supports the petals once they bloom.
Outermost Whorl
The outermost circle or arrangement of parts in a flower, typically consisting of sepals.
Ovule
The structure in seed plants that develops into a seed after fertilization, containing a female gametophyte and the egg cell.
